Question unclear: Gleason score for prostate cancer depends upon a biopsy or tissue diagnosis of a surgical prostatectomy specimen. Gleason graded according to microscopic appearance of cancer grades between 1-5. 1 being least malignant. Score is obtained by adding grade # of most prevalent cell type to grade # of second most prevalent cell type. Thus grade4 + grade 3 gets a gleason score of 7.

Not possible: There is no way to get a gleason score without a biopsy. The grade is determined by the pathologist's interpretation of an actual tissue sample, and the two most commonly seen patterns are added together to get a gleason score.
